Mutual Non-Disclosure Agreement.

Our standard mutual NDA governs the exchange of confidential information during discovery calls, process audits, and due diligence. It can be executed within two business days.

MutualObligations on both parties equally — Coaley Peak is bound by the same confidentiality obligations as the client.
Duration2 years from last disclosure, or 5 years from engagement start — whichever is longer.
Governing lawEngland & Wales, London seat.
ExecutionCountersigned by a Coaley Peak director — no other Coaley Peak signature is valid.

How to Execute the NDA

The NDA is not valid until signed by both parties. This page and the NDA text page set out the standard terms only.

1

Email legal@coaleypeak.co.uk with your organisation name, registered company number, and the name and title of your authorised signatory.

2

We send a countersigned NDA from a serving Coaley Peak director within two business days.

3

Both parties retain a copy. The NDA is in force from the date of the last signature.
